What is a Door with Sliding Window?
A door with a sliding window incorporates a traditional sliding door mechanism with a window feature, offering an extensive view while maintaining ease of access. This style enables natural light to flood into a space, creating an inviting atmosphere, while also using easy access to outside locations. This performance makes them perfect for patio areas, terraces, or garden entryways, where indoor and outdoor living often assemble.

When going with a door with a sliding window, it's necessary to think about various factors to make sure the selection fulfills your specific needs. Here are a few considerations:
Space Availability: Evaluate the area where you want to install the door. Procedure the opening to make sure a correct fit.Product Selection: Choose a material that aligns with your visual desires and functional requirements.Security Features: Look for doors geared up with robust locks and security steps to secure your home.Glass Type: Select energy-efficient glass to help in preserving indoor temperatures, particularly in severe weather condition conditions.Spending plan: Determine your budget plan beforehand, as rates can vary substantially based on materials and modification options.Frequently asked questions About Doors with Sliding Windows
Q1: Are doors with sliding windows energy efficient?A1: Yes, numerous contemporary sliding doors are constructed with energy-efficient glass choices to decrease heat loss and preserve indoor temperature. Q2: How do I preserve a door with a
sliding window?A2: Regularly clean the tracks and the glass to avoid debris
build-up, and check seals and locks periodically for functionality. Q3: Can I set up a sliding door with a window myself?A3: While it's
possible for skilled DIY enthusiasts, professional installation is recommended to ensure it's fitted properly and firmly. Q4: What designs are available for doors with sliding windows?A4: There are numerous styles, from contemporary to standard, consisting of multi-panel styles and different frame products. Q5: Are these doors ideal for all climates?A5: Yes, with the appropriate materials and insulation functions, doors with sliding windows can be effective in different climates.
